-
Notifications
You must be signed in to change notification settings - Fork 1
/
phpdoc.yaml
128 lines (123 loc) · 5.41 KB
/
phpdoc.yaml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
title: comhisto - référentiel de l'historique des communes (V2)
path: /yamldoc/pub/comhisto
doc: |
A faire:
- faire un site spécifique static.georef.eu pour les fichiers leaflet, ...
- améliorer replaces/replacedBy sur le fondement de l'elit
Construction et diffusion d'un référentiel historique des communes depuis le 1er janvier 1943.
Réutilisation du code produit dans rpicom, renommage du projet.
Plusieurs formes de mise à disposition:
- documentation sur https://github.com/benoitdavidfr/comhisto
- fichier Yaml de l'historique (4,9 Mo) -> https://georef.eu/yamldoc/pub/comhisto/elits2/histelitp.yaml
- avec son schéma et sa doc
- fichier GéoJSON (55 Mo) utilisable dans un SIG
-> https://static.data.gouv.fr/resources/code-officiel-geographique-cog/20200920-175314/comhistog3.geojson
- GéoJSON zippé (6 Mo) -> https://github.com/benoitdavidfr/comhisto/blob/master/export/(comhistog3|elit).7z
- visualisation interactive Html de chaque version de code Insee avec carte Leaflet associée
-> https://georef.eu/yamldoc/pub/comhisto/map/
- URI/API d'accès à chaque entité -> https://comhisto.georef.eu/
avec restitution en fonction du paramètre Http Accept:
- soit en Html avec inclusion du JSON-LD dans l'en-tête (par défaut dans un navigateur),
- soit en JSON-LD.
- OGC API Features -> https://comhisto.geoapi.fr/
- MD DCAT https://comhisto.georef.eu/ référencant plusieurs distributions
- fichier GéoJSON -> https://static.data.gouv.fr/...
- fichier GéoJSON zippé -> https://github.com/benoitdavidfr/comhisto/...
- fichier Yaml/JSON -> https://comhisto.georef.eu/histelitp.yaml
- URI/API d'accès en JSON-GéoJSON/html/JSON-LD -> https://comhisto.georef.eu/api/
- la version html intègre la description JSON-LD dans l'en-tête de la page
- OGC API Features -> https://comhisto.geoapi.fr/
Urls:
- http://localhost/yamldoc/pub/comhisto/ - en local
- https://georef.eu/yamldoc/pub/comhisto/ - sur Alwaysdata
- https://comhisto.georef.eu/ - URI API
- https://comhisto.geoapi.fr/ - OGC API
Terminologie:
- version valide/périmée à une date
- version courante/actuelle = valide à la date de validité du référentiel
synchro: http://localhost/synchro.php?remote=http://georef.eu/&dir=yamldoc/pub/comhisto
journal: |
20/3/2021:
- ajout incr pour produire le réf. au 1/1/2021 à partir de celui au 1/1/2020
18/12/2020:
- création utilisateur comhisto/Comhisto123456 sur Ovh et transfert connexion base vers Ovh suite à problèmes sur Alwaysdata
10/12/2020:
- correction de polygones parasites dans comhistog3
- réexport de comhistog3, copie sur github, data.gouv et Alwaysdata
4/12/2020:
- gestion de l'espace de noms https://comhisto.georef.eu/ns
2/12/2020:
- chargement en base des chefs-lieux définis par un point
30/11-1/12/2020:
- annonce sur GéoRézo
- ajout du géocodeur
25-29/11/2020:
- ajout de l'API ogcapi
13-21/11/2020:
- ajout de l'API renommée ensuite uriapi
11-12/11/2020:
- ajout visu carto
20/10-9/11/2020:
- écriture d'une nlle version de insee améliorant notamment la doc des erreurs Insee
- archivage v1 (targz -> archives)
- évolution de croise2 pour traiter les écarts Insee/IGN sur 14114/14712 et 52224/52064
- génération des nouvelles couches, maj sur data.gouv.fr
23/9/2020:
- correction erreur sur 78613/91613 (Thionville)
- ajout St Barth et St Martin
22/9/2020:
- écriture du schéma JSON de comhistog3
20/9/2020:
- détection d'erreurs et corrections
- publication sur data.gouv
15/9/2020:
- gestion du cas de Lyon
12/9/2020:
- recopie dans comhistog3 de propriétés issues de histelitp.yaml
- génération des com. déléguées propres
- reste erreur sur Lyon, StBarth et StMartin
10/9/2020:
- restructuration en cours de zones en elits
9/9/2020:
- export GeoJSON assez correct, commit et push
- reste erreur sur Lyon non traitée
29/8/2020:
- réécriture => abandon V1
8/7/2020:
- création à la suite de rpicom pour réécrire le code
submodules:
- /yamldoc/pub/comhisto/data
- /yamldoc/pub/comhisto/data2
# archivé - /yamldoc/pub/comhisto/insee
- /yamldoc/pub/comhisto/insee2
# archivé - /yamldoc/pub/comhisto/elits
- /yamldoc/pub/comhisto/elits2
- /yamldoc/pub/comhisto/ign
- /yamldoc/pub/comhisto/stbarthmartin
- /yamldoc/pub/comhisto/cheflieu
# archivé - /yamldoc/pub/comhisto/croise
- /yamldoc/pub/comhisto/croise2
- /yamldoc/pub/comhisto/export
- /yamldoc/pub/comhisto/lib
- /yamldoc/pub/comhisto/map
- /yamldoc/pub/comhisto/uriapi
- /yamldoc/pub/comhisto/ogcapi
- /yamldoc/pub/comhisto/geocodeur
- /yamldoc/pub/comhisto/incr
sqlDBs:
- name: comhistoPg
title: comhisto - base PostGis comhisto
doc: |
Utilisée en production et en consultation pour stocker le référentiel comhistog3
localhost: 'host=172.17.0.4 dbname=gis user=docker'
else: 'host=postgresql-bdavid.alwaysdata.net dbname=bdavid_comhisto user=bdavid_comhisto password=motdepasse123$'
- name: comhistoMysql
title: comhisto - base MySql comhisto
doc: |
Utilisée pour le log
localhost: 'mysql://root:***@172.17.0.3/comhisto'
else: 'mysql://bdavid:***@mysql-bdavid.alwaysdata.net/bdavid_comhisto'
phpScripts:
#- /yamldoc/pub/comhisto/index.php
phpIncludes:
htmlFiles: